From 267a8bcfe86f4f58f6f742b6981d94e1ed7d8bd2 Mon Sep 17 00:00:00 2001 From: Yigit Sever Date: Tue, 9 Aug 2022 14:19:54 +0300 Subject: zsteg: Adopted --- zsteg/.SRCINFO | 17 +++++++++++++++++ zsteg/PKGBUILD | 22 ++++++++++++++++++++++ 2 files changed, 39 insertions(+) create mode 100644 zsteg/.SRCINFO create mode 100644 zsteg/PKGBUILD (limited to 'zsteg') diff --git a/zsteg/.SRCINFO b/zsteg/.SRCINFO new file mode 100644 index 0000000..6cca372 --- /dev/null +++ b/zsteg/.SRCINFO @@ -0,0 +1,17 @@ +pkgbase = zsteg + pkgdesc = detect stegano-hidden data in PNG & BMP + pkgver = 0.2.2 + pkgrel = 1 + url = https://github.com/zed-0xff/zsteg + arch = any + license = MIT + depends = ruby + depends = ruby-zpng + depends = ruby-iostruct + noextract = zsteg-0.2.2.gem + options = !emptydirs + source = https://rubygems.org/downloads/zsteg-0.2.2.gem + sha256sums = f3f6bbaf46e5c9f0598aa8b8f457dad890873e4c4e382f6c22e408fd34958ad7 + +pkgname = zsteg + diff --git a/zsteg/PKGBUILD b/zsteg/PKGBUILD new file mode 100644 index 0000000..1a49d80 --- /dev/null +++ b/zsteg/PKGBUILD @@ -0,0 +1,22 @@ +# Maintainer: gryffyn + +_gemname=zsteg +pkgname=$_gemname +pkgver=0.2.2 +pkgrel=1 +pkgdesc="detect stegano-hidden data in PNG & BMP" +arch=(any) +url='https://github.com/zed-0xff/zsteg' +license=(MIT) +depends=('ruby' 'ruby-zpng' 'ruby-iostruct') +options=(!emptydirs) +source=("https://rubygems.org/downloads/$_gemname-$pkgver.gem") +noextract=($_gemname-$pkgver.gem) +sha256sums=('f3f6bbaf46e5c9f0598aa8b8f457dad890873e4c4e382f6c22e408fd34958ad7') + +package() { + local _gemdir="$(ruby -rrubygems -e'puts Gem.default_dir')" + install -d -m 755 ${pkgdir}/usr/bin + gem install --ignore-dependencies --no-user-install -i "$pkgdir/$_gemdir" -n "$pkgdir/usr/bin" "$_gemname-$pkgver.gem" + rm "${pkgdir}/${_gemdir}/cache/${_gemname}-${pkgver}.gem" +} -- cgit v1.2.3-70-g09d2